XCode IOS 模拟器没有将我的任务置于后台
XCode IOS simulator doesn't put my task to background
我有 XCode 8.3.3.,正在测试一个可以进行 REST API 调用的应用程序。当在前台打开另一个应用程序(一些股票模拟器应用程序:日历、新闻等)时,我的应用程序仍然继续定期进行 REST 调用。这不是真实设备上发生的情况 (iPhone 5S)。即使我将模拟器锁在外面,它也会发出呼叫。
这是有意为之的行为吗?如何获得真正的设备合规性?
谢谢
问题在评论里回答了。
基本上XCode模拟器不执行后台任务。
好消息:从 Xcode 9 Beta 3 开始,我们暂停了模拟器中的后台进程。
我有 XCode 8.3.3.,正在测试一个可以进行 REST API 调用的应用程序。当在前台打开另一个应用程序(一些股票模拟器应用程序:日历、新闻等)时,我的应用程序仍然继续定期进行 REST 调用。这不是真实设备上发生的情况 (iPhone 5S)。即使我将模拟器锁在外面,它也会发出呼叫。
这是有意为之的行为吗?如何获得真正的设备合规性? 谢谢
问题在评论里回答了。
基本上XCode模拟器不执行后台任务。
好消息:从 Xcode 9 Beta 3 开始,我们暂停了模拟器中的后台进程。